Shotzi on Getting a Tattoo in Tribute to Bray Wyatt
– During a recent interview with The Ten Count’s Steve Fall for Wrestling News.co, WWE Superstar Shotzi discussed getting a tattoo in tribute to the late Bray Wyatt, who tragically passed last August. Shotzi credits Wyatt for getting her into wrestling. Below are some highlights:
On getting a tattoo in tribute to bray Wyatt: “I kind of credit me getting into wrestling because of him, like actually starting to wrestle because I had just dropped out of musical theater college and I wanted to find an outlet for performing and I started watching WWE again. The first crew that I noticed was the Wyatt Family. Me and my sister thought that they were just so cool and we wanted to be the female version of them, and then the rest is history. After watching them, I signed up for wrestling school like a week later and just started taking my first bumps. So I definitely credit Bray Wyatt for turning me into a wrestler.”
